AYDEN — Kristen Nichole Freeman of Goldsboro and Anthony Bradford Evans of Mount Olive exchanged vows in a double-ring ceremony May 15 at 5 p.m. at Elm Grove Original Free Will Baptist Church, with Dr. Franklin Baggett officiating.

The bride is the daughter of Thomas and Theresa Conwell Freeman of Goldsboro and the granddaughter of William and Claudia Freeman of Orlando, Fla., and Charles Conwell and the late Phyllis Conwell of Goldsboro.

She graduated from Eastern Wayne High School in 2004 and Mount Olive College in 2008 with a bachelor’s degree in psychology. She is employed with BB&T in Wilson.

The groom is the son of Anthony and Pamela Smithwick Evans of Grifton and the grandson of Mr. and Mrs. Henry Evans and the late Betty Lou Evans of Ayden and Charles and Annetta Smithwick of Grifton.

He graduated from Ayden Grifton High School in 2002 and Mount Olive College in 2006 with a bachelor’s degree in recreation and leisure studies. He is employed with Mount Olive College.

The bride was escorted by her father and given in marriage by her parents.

She wore a white strapless A-line gown covered with Alencon lace appliqués covered with crystals and bugle beads. The hemline of the gown was completed with an Alencon lace scallop. The chapel-length train featured matching appliqués and lace trim.

Her headpiece was a fingertip-length veil trimmed in crystals made by her mother.

The bride carried a bouquet of roses, peonies, calla lilies, ranunculus, green hypericum berries and lime orchids.

Erica Freeman was her sister’s maid of honor.

Bridesmaids were Rebecca Seagle, friend of the bride; Nisia Broadie, cousin of the bride; and Kelley Evans, sister-in-law of the groom.

Anthony Evans was his son’s best man.

Groomsmen were Jordan Evans, brother of the groom, and John Pearson and Michael Garrett, friends of the groom.

Donna Tyson directed the wedding. Presiding at the register was Athena Letchworth. Ashley Smith and Sara Letchworth distributed programs.

A program of wedding music was provided by Steve Letchworth, pianist, and Brian Letchworth and Kelley Evans, vocalists.

Following the ceremony, a dinner and dance reception was held at the church.

After their wedding trip to Playa del Carmen, Mexico, the couple will reside in Mount Olive.

Events held before the wedding included a Christmas shower Jan. 9 hosted by Jordan and Kelley Evans; a wedding shower April 11 hosted by Elm Grove Original Free Will Baptist Church; a bachelorette and lingerie shower April 24 and 25 hosted by Erica Freeman and Athena Letchworth; a bachelor weekend April 24 and 25 hosted by the groom’s friends; a miscellaneous shower May 6 hosted by co-workers of the bride, a bridesmaids’ luncheon May 8 at Murphy’s Place hosted by Annetta Smithwick and Pamela Evans; and a miscellaneous shower hosted by the groom’s co-workers.

The groom’s parents hosted a rehearsal dinner at the church.
